Art's-Way, an agricultural machinery manufacturer, is closely linked to farmers' well-being. Its shares rise, outperforming the market, when crop prices are high and farmers are upgrading their equipment fleets. During periods of low agricultural prices and droughts, its performance lags the market.

This chart for Art's-Way is an indicator of the health of the US agricultural sector. The company produces niche agricultural equipment (feed dispensers, sugar beet harvesters). When grain and livestock prices are high, farmers spend money, and the oscillator becomes overheated (above 70). Drought, low commodity prices, or rising interest rates lead to oversold conditions.
